Banks and oil offset retail gains

The FTSE 100 Index has edged up 13.8 points to 3834.4, with gains in retail and telecoms shares offset by weakness in the banking and oil sectors.

Safeway is up 8.75p to 313.75p, a 3% rise, after Philip Green, who owns Bhs and Arcadia, said he was considering a cash offer for the business.
